 ///<summary>Inserts one ApptFieldDef into the database.  Returns the new priKey.</summary>
 internal static long Insert(ApptFieldDef apptFieldDef)
 {
     if (DataConnection.DBtype == DatabaseType.Oracle)
     {
         apptFieldDef.ApptFieldDefNum = DbHelper.GetNextOracleKey("apptfielddef", "ApptFieldDefNum");
         int loopcount = 0;
         while (loopcount < 100)
         {
             try {
                 return(Insert(apptFieldDef, true));
             }
             catch (Oracle.DataAccess.Client.OracleException ex) {
                 if (ex.Number == 1 && ex.Message.ToLower().Contains("unique constraint") && ex.Message.ToLower().Contains("violated"))
                 {
                     apptFieldDef.ApptFieldDefNum++;
                     loopcount++;
                 }
                 else
                 {
                     throw ex;
                 }
             }
         }
         throw new ApplicationException("Insert failed.  Could not generate primary key.");
     }
     else
     {
         return(Insert(apptFieldDef, false));
     }
 }

        ///<summary>Updates one ApptFieldDef in the database.  Uses an old object to compare to, and only alters changed fields.  This prevents collisions and concurrency problems in heavily used tables.  Returns true if an update occurred.</summary>
        public static bool Update(ApptFieldDef apptFieldDef, ApptFieldDef oldApptFieldDef)
        {
            string command = "";

            if (apptFieldDef.FieldName != oldApptFieldDef.FieldName)
            {
                if (command != "")
                {
                    command += ",";
                }
                command += "FieldName = '" + POut.String(apptFieldDef.FieldName) + "'";
            }
            if (apptFieldDef.FieldType != oldApptFieldDef.FieldType)
            {
                if (command != "")
                {
                    command += ",";
                }
                command += "FieldType = " + POut.Int((int)apptFieldDef.FieldType) + "";
            }
            if (apptFieldDef.PickList != oldApptFieldDef.PickList)
            {
                if (command != "")
                {
                    command += ",";
                }
                command += "PickList = " + DbHelper.ParamChar + "paramPickList";
            }
            if (command == "")
            {
                return(false);
            }
            if (apptFieldDef.PickList == null)
            {
                apptFieldDef.PickList = "";
            }
            OdSqlParameter paramPickList = new OdSqlParameter("paramPickList", OdDbType.Text, POut.StringParam(apptFieldDef.PickList));

            command = "UPDATE apptfielddef SET " + command
                      + " WHERE ApptFieldDefNum = " + POut.Long(apptFieldDef.ApptFieldDefNum);
            Db.NonQ(command, paramPickList);
            return(true);
        }
